Transaction aabbcc6441e6d63101155fc0947a62c601abab010800008f6120a81789885808
1 Input
1 Output
-
aabbcc6441e6d63101155fc0947a62c601abab010800008f6120a81789885808:0
- value
- 31760
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 81d6debe92dc1f5849112d3bdd3260da6718292af5a7bdd7dfdb83ad86082528
- address
- bc1ps8tda05jms04sjg395aa6vnqmfn3s2f27knmm47lmwp6mpsgy55qpskyzw